Pros of buying 1961-1974 Pontiac Bonneville ignition breaker points:1. Inexpensive: Breaker points are relatively cheap compared to other parts like ignition coils and distributors.
2. Availability: Breaker points are still widely available in the aftermarket, making it easy to find replacements.
3. Simple installation: Breaker points are easy to install and replace, requiring minimal tools and mechanical knowledge.
Cons of buying 1961-1974 Pontiac Bonneville ignition breaker points:1. Wear and tear: Breaker points wear out over time, which can cause misfires, rough idling, and difficulty starting the engine.
2. Inefficiency: Breaker points are less efficient than modern electronic ignition systems, which can result in poor fuel economy and increased emissions.
3. Limited lifespan: Breaker points have a limited lifespan, typically ranging from 20,000 to 50,000 miles, and may need to be replaced more frequently than other parts.
Conclusion:If you own a 1961-1974 Pontiac Bonneville and are looking for a cheap and easy fix for your ignition system, breaker points may be a viable option. However, it's important to consider the potential drawbacks, such as their limited lifespan and inefficiency compared to modern electronic ignition systems. Ultimately, the decision to replace breaker points depends on your budget, mechanical skill level, and desired performance.
Recommendation:If you're looking for a long-term solution, consider upgrading to a modern electronic ignition system. While it may require more investment upfront, it will provide better fuel economy, reduced emissions, and a more reliable ignition system. If you're on a tight budget or just looking for a temporary fix, breaker points may be a suitable option. Just be prepared to replace them more frequently and accept that you'll be sacrificing some performance.
